From war-torn streets to fashion runways, Scooter Nation is the definitive story of how two tiny wheels came to move the modern world. This richly told narrative traces the remarkable rise of Vespa and Lambretta-from their roots in post-WWII Italy to their cultural explosions in Britain, Asia, and beyond. Whether as icons of Mod rebellion, lifelines in the crowded streets of Jakarta, or trendsetters in electric urban design, scooters have never just been transport-they've been symbols of freedom, class, gender, and innovation.

Blending sharp design history with global economic insight, and tracing the scooter's unlikely path through cinema, politics, and protest, this book captures an untold history of modern mobility. With deep storytelling and vivid characters-from factory founders to modern-day restorers-Scooter Nation shows how the humble scooter transformed cities, reshaped lives, and built a world in motion.
